ZERO is an ongoing exploration of form, perception, and temporality. Drawing from the spirit of Chinese Shanshui painting, I translate the idea of landscape into new material dimensions—creating works that hover between surface and object, print and sculpture. Each piece is built through layers of silkscreen prints and acrylic on wood, forming terrains that appear both constructed and organic.
In ZERO series, I experiment with a new kind of screen printing that exists between the surface and the spatial, inviting viewers to move around the work, to sense time as cyclical and continuous. These works are not only representations of landscapes, but also meditations on how space, rhythm, and stillness coexist within the act of seeing.
